7. Kernel choices and tweaks
- Use stock kernel included with a ROM unless the ROM or device community recommends a custom kernel (improvements in schedulers, I/O).
- f2fs vs ext4: If eMMC supports f2fs and a kernel provides support, formatting /data as f2fs can improve performance for some workloads—but it requires a compatible kernel and recovery.
- Governor tuning: “ondemand” or “interactive” for responsiveness; “conservative” for battery. Bench and monitor battery/thermals.

Breathing New Life into the Samsung Galaxy Tab A6 (SM-T280) Is your Samsung Galaxy Tab A6 (SM-T280) feeling a bit sluggish? Released in 2016, this 7-inch tablet is a classic, but its official Android 5.1 software has long since fallen behind modern app requirements.
